Coloring tips: How to color Clown Magic Show Stage coloring page well?
Use bright and cheerful colors for the clown’s outfit, such as red, yellow, and blue. Color the clown’s hat with a bright color and add a contrasting color for the flower on it. The stage curtains can be deep red or purple to make the clown stand out. Use green or brown for the table and props, and soft colors for the audience’s clothes to keep focus on the clown. For the stars and lights, use yellows and whites to create a magical glow effect.
